In this episode of Science is All Around You, we delve into the fascinating world of physics education using the one device almost everyone carries: a smartphone. Highlighting the untapped potential of these powerful tools, we explore how their built-in sensors and features can transform them into portable laboratories for mechanics, optics, sound, and electromagnetism.
From determining the resonance frequency of a guitar string and measuring speed using the Doppler effect to calibrating a smartphone as a microscope for onion cell measurements and estimating the size of the Earth, we discuss hands-on experiments that are both educational and accessible. With clear explanations and everyday materials, this episode demonstrates how science can truly be all around us—right in the palm of our hands.
